We have 3 Golden Rules on the Farm. These are the non-negotiables. Yes, I even used some all-caps. That’s how much we mean this!

1.) If you are mounted on a horse or motorcycle on this property, you must have an appropriate helmet on. No exceptions.

2.) No Smoking within 50 Ft of ANY building entrance. This includes the pool area. Do not leave butts on the ground. Do not accidentally set our farm on fire flicking ashes around. Have some common sense and be courteous. Do not dispose of butts in indoor trash cans. Please throw them in one of the trash cans outside.

3.) All guest dogs must be kept on leash AT ALL TIMES on the property. It’s not a request. I don’t care if Cesar Milan himself uses your dog as an example of the greatest of all dog-kind. We can’t pick and choose who has to be on leash. There is no interview process. We’re not willing to risk our animals, wildlife, or guests. Leash up or stay somewhere else. No, remote collars don’t count. I know I sound like kind of a jerk about this. We love dogs, truly, but we have had so many issues that we are on the verge of not allowing dogs anymore. We have had major property damage, fights, and injuries. Days spent trying to clean dog hair out of the pool. Phone calls about injured wildlife that we have to go and euthanize. We are the ones that are in the paddock with panicked horses trying to intercept someone’s dog and prevent injuries because they had no idea their dog would chase a horse. We don’t owe anyone an explanation of why we have our policies. But here it is. We have the leash rule for a reason.
